Large bubbles of water vapor quickly form underneath … WebDec 13, 2024 · The Superheated Water Phenomenon There is something that can happen with microwave-boiled water called the superheated water phenomenon. This is when the water is actually boiling and very hot, but is not bubbling and appears to be calm and cool.
